Beaver IoT
Open-Source IoT Platform

Beaver IoT empowers developers to build integrations and loT projects through
fexible coding. The platform's built-in functions can also be leveraged for
quick proof-of-concept for those without programming skills.

Getting Started

  • Functions
  • Users
  • Resources
  • HOME
  • SOFTWARE&PLATFORM
  • BEAVER IOT

Build Your Dashboard in 10 Minutes

Beaver IoT is super user-friendly. Using customizable widgets, you can quickly insert charts and other visualization types to display data and make
business dynamics clear at a glance.

beaver iot dashboard

Rich Widgets

Beaver IoT provides various widgets, including Data Charts, Operable Widgets, and Data Cards.

Customizable

You can also rearrange widgets and adjust data displays for a personalized and optimal user experience, even changing color schemes.

Interactivity

Through the dashboard, you can engage directly with their IoT systems. You can call services and execute commands seamlessly.

workflow page

Workflow

Through nodes, workflows can sequence multiple tasks or operations for automatic execution, effectively managing your loT systems and streamlining complex processes

Custom Entity

For those node types involving entities, you can add more flexibility to your workflows by creating custom entities to serve as judgment indicators or hold values resulting from logical processing.

Open Possibilities through
Integrations

For developers with programming capabilities, Integration is the core power of Beaver IoT to leverage. Through integrations, developers can seamlessly connect a wide range of devices, services, and third-party systems to create highly customized and innovative loT solutions.

icon1

Devices

icon4

Entities

icon3

Workflow

icon5

Attributes

icon8

Analytics

icon2

Software

icon6

Time

icon10

Protocol

icon7

Services

icon9

Data

Integrations

What Can You Do with Integrations

Access and monitor your devices,
making provisions and adjustments

For example:
Integrate environmental sensors, setting
them up and making changes

01

Access entities from your integrations and
call services

For example:
Get rain alert from your weather forecast
integration and check current weather details

02

Extend the platform's current
capabilities

For example:
Build personalized reports using
data analytics integrations

03
Learn more about integrations and entities >

Business Users

who can benfit from beaver iot icon 3
  • Rapidly prototype IoT concepts
  • Drag-and-drop data dashboards

System Integrators

who can benfit from beaver iot icon 1
  • Quickly validate concepts with platform's built-in functions
  • Customize integrations for specialized needs

Developers

who can benfit from beaver iot icon 2
  • Build custom integrations using open-source codes for extended possibilities
  • Connect hardware, software, cloud services and more

Who Can Benefit from
Beaver IoT?

Beaver IoT empowers developers to build IoT projects with advanced integrations through coding, and allows those without development capabilities to rapidly prototype ideas - all on one flexible platform.

beaver iot qa

Q: Do I need development capabilities to use Beaver IoT?

A: Beaver IoT's default capabilities can be used for Proof-of-Concept (PoC) projects. You do need development skills if you want to go beyond that.

Q: Can the integrations include non-Milesight devices?

A: Absolutely! We made Beaver IoT open-source because we want to extend the possibilities of IoT projects. While integrating Milesight devices is one natural option, we would love you to explore many more integrations!

Q:I don't have a physical device on-hand. Can I still test the dashboard functions?

A: You bet. Beaver IoT comes with the Milesight Development Platform integration, which allows you to use the platform's demo devices. Even better, you can customize the demo devices on Milesight Development Platform.

Learn more about Milesight Development Platform.

Q: Is Beaver IoT free?

A: Yes. Our open-source platform is completely free to use, and we utilize the MIT License, which is one of the most permissive open-source licenses available. This means you can freely use, modify, and distribute our platform, making it an ideal choice for developers looking to build innovative IoT solutions without worrying about licensing fees or restrictions.

Q: Do you have a cloud version?

A: Not yet but we do have a test cloud environment for users to experience what the platform is like. Fill in this form or email our product service expert Evie at evie@milesight.com to get a test account.

Why Beaver IoT

icon13

Intuitive Dashboard

For data collection, processing,
and visualization

icon workflow

Workflow

Streamline and automate tasks and
operations for enhanced control and
efficiency

icon user

User & Role Management

Define and manage user permissions for devices, integrations, and dashboards

icon12

Flexible Customization

Not requiring any application
development skills

icon11

Cross-Platform Deployment

Deploy where you like using Docker

icon14

On the Cloud or On-Premise

Choose cloud or on-premise
according to your needs

icon15

Open-Source under MIT

You can freely extend the
platform's possibilities

icon16

Not Vendor-Binding

Integrations can be made with products from Milesight or any other brand

icon21

Tutorial & documents

Explore various development resources that faciliate your
understanding and guide you through key processes.

Explore documents
icon20

Join Our Developer Communities

For platform updates, Q&As, discussions, and support from us and
your peers.

*Your Email

*Country

*Your Phone

*Company

*Your Website

*Business Type

*What Product are You Interested in?

*Message

*Verification Code

Verify Code

If you are interested in Milesight, please leave us a message.

Verify Code

Contact Us

Contact Us

Verify Code

Contact Us to Get More Information